Course Overview

The Cooling Tower Technician Certificate Course focuses on the practical technical skills required to operate, inspect, maintain, and troubleshoot cooling towers used in HVAC chiller plants and industrial cooling systems.

Cooling towers are commonly used in commercial buildings, hospitals, hotels, shopping malls, data centers, high-rise towers, district cooling buildings, industrial plants, factories, and facility management projects. A cooling tower plays a major role in removing heat from the condenser water system and supporting efficient water-cooled chiller operation.

Learners will understand how cooling towers work, how condenser water circulates, how cooling tower components are inspected, how preventive maintenance is performed, how water treatment affects system performance, and how common faults are identified and reported.

Why Choose This Course?

Cooling towers are critical for water-cooled HVAC systems. Poor cooling tower maintenance can cause high condenser water temperature, chiller high-pressure trips, poor cooling performance, scale formation, biological growth, water loss, corrosion, fan problems, pump issues, and high energy consumption.

A skilled cooling tower technician must understand both cooling tower operation and practical maintenance procedures. This course helps learners build confidence in real field tasks such as basin cleaning, nozzle inspection, fill inspection, fan and motor checking, drift eliminator inspection, water treatment awareness, condenser water monitoring, and fault reporting.
